1. Material and Construction

The material and construction of a logger boot are crucial factors in determining its durability, comfort, and safety.

  • Leather: The most common material for logger boots is leather, prized for its durability, water resistance, and breathability. Full-grain leather is the highest quality, offering the best combination of these properties.
    • Thickness: Look for boots with thick leather uppers, typically 7-9 ounces in weight. This will provide ample protection and support.
    • Tanning: Different tanning processes can affect the leather’s properties. Oil-tanned leather is more water-resistant, while vegetable-tanned leather is more durable.
  • Nylon: Nylon is often used in the boot’s lining and stitching, providing added strength and abrasion resistance.
    • Denier: Look for high-denier nylon, which is more durable and resistant to tearing.
  • Steel: Steel is used in the shank and toe of the boot, providing essential protection.
    • Shank: The steel shank provides arch support and prevents the boot from twisting or bending excessively.
    • Toe: The steel toe protects the foot from impact and compression injuries.
  • Construction Methods:
    • Goodyear Welt: This is the most common construction method for logger boots, known for its durability and ability to be resoled.
    • Stitchdown: This method involves stitching the upper directly to the outsole, creating a flexible and lightweight boot.
    • Cemented: This method uses adhesive to attach the upper to the outsole, resulting in a less durable but more affordable boot.

My experience: I’ve always preferred Goodyear welted boots made from full-grain leather. They’re more expensive upfront, but they last much longer and can be resoled multiple times, making them a better value in the long run.

2. Heel Height and Design

The heel height and design are critical factors in determining the boot’s grip, stability, and overall performance.

  • Heel Height: Logger boot heels typically range from 1.5 to 2.5 inches in height.
    • Lower Heel (1.5-2 inches): Provides good stability and is suitable for general logging work.
    • Higher Heel (2-2.5 inches): Offers enhanced grip and leverage, ideal for steep terrain and heavy tool use.
  • Heel Design:
    • Stacked Leather Heel: This is a traditional design, offering excellent durability and shock absorption.
    • Rubber Heel: Rubber heels provide good grip and are more resistant to wear and tear.
    • Combination Heel: Some boots feature a combination of leather and rubber, offering the best of both worlds.
  • Heel Breast: The heel breast is the forward-facing part of the heel. A wider heel breast provides more stability, while a narrower heel breast allows for better maneuverability.
  • Heel Shape:
    • Undercut Heel: The heel is slightly narrower at the top than at the bottom, providing a more secure grip.
    • Block Heel: The heel is a uniform shape, offering good stability and support.

My experience: I prefer a heel height of around 2 inches with an undercut heel design. This provides a good balance of grip, stability, and maneuverability.

3. Outsole and Tread Pattern

The outsole and tread pattern are crucial for providing traction on various surfaces.

  • Outsole Material:
    • Rubber: The most common material for logger boot outsoles, offering good grip, durability, and abrasion resistance.
      • Types of Rubber:
        • Nitrile Rubber: Highly resistant to oil, chemicals, and heat.
        • Vibram Rubber: Known for its excellent grip and durability.
        • TPU (Thermoplastic Polyurethane): Lightweight and flexible, offering good shock absorption.
    • Leather: Leather outsoles are less common but offer a classic look and good flexibility.
  • Tread Pattern:
    • Lug Pattern: Deep, aggressive lugs provide excellent traction on loose or muddy surfaces.
    • Cleated Pattern: Similar to lug patterns, but with more defined cleats for enhanced grip.
    • Siping: Small slits in the outsole that improve traction on wet or icy surfaces.

My experience: I always look for outsoles made from Vibram rubber with a deep lug pattern. This provides the best traction on the variety of surfaces I encounter in the woods.

2. Conditioning

Conditioning keeps the leather supple and prevents it from drying out and cracking.

  • Leather Conditioner: Apply a leather conditioner every few weeks, or more often if your boots are exposed to harsh conditions.
    • Neatsfoot Oil: A traditional leather conditioner that penetrates deeply and softens the leather.
    • Mink Oil: A water-resistant conditioner that protects against moisture and salt.
    • Leather Cream: A lighter conditioner that’s ideal for everyday use.
  • Applying Conditioner: Apply a small amount of conditioner to a clean cloth and rub it into the leather in a circular motion. Allow the conditioner to soak in for several hours before wearing your boots.

My experience: I prefer to use neatsfoot oil on my logger boots. It keeps the leather soft and supple, and it helps to repel water.
